State Land Registry
The challenge
Land records existed only on paper across multiple archive sites, taking weeks to retrieve for a single transaction and creating opportunities for disputed or duplicated claims.
The solution
DreamImp ran a phased digitization program, scanning and verifying records against physical archives, then recording final entries on a blockchain-backed registry for tamper-evident provenance.
Timeline
Archive audit · Months 1–2
Catalogued existing paper archives across all sites.
Digitization · Months 3–6
Scanned, verified, and cross-referenced records in phases.
Registry build · Months 5–7
Built the blockchain-backed digital registry in parallel.
Staff handover · Months 8–9
Trained registry staff and completed final cutover.
